Output b70576c32447393cc13f954aadc9ef5dc7b39d4075742649da29674349625f90:1

value
658960
script pubkey
OP_0 OP_PUSHBYTES_20 d44b0444cb2237fb943c338c741457e59d93e30a
address
ltc1q639sg3xtygmlh9puxwx8g9zhukwe8cc2w7x2yd
transaction
b70576c32447393cc13f954aadc9ef5dc7b39d4075742649da29674349625f90
spent
true